#418ab2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#418ab2 is composed of 25.5% red, 54.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 201.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#418ab2 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ffff with #001565.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#418ab2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#418ab2 has RGB values of R:65, G:138,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4295346.

Shades and Tints of #418ab2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020406 is the darkest color, while #f6fafc is the lightest one.
